Cybersecurity shouldn’t always be about playing defense – it can also be about disrupting attackers before they succeed. In this Deep Dive, host Lieuwe Jan Koning and cybersecurity expert Rick Howard break down the Intrusion Kill Chain and the strategic shift it introduced in the world of cybersecurity.

  • How does the Intrusion Kill Chain flip the script on cyberattacks?
  • The 250 active adversary campaigns that security teams must track
  • How MITRE ATT&CK and the Diamond Model strengthen modern defense strategies
  • Why global governments and intelligence agencies aren’t doing more to share cyber threat intelligence

Despite decades of talk about intelligence sharing, most information is still exchanged manually, often via spreadsheets. As Howard points out, a true global threat-sharing framework could give defenders the upper hand.
